Admissions
University of Dallas admits 54.2% of applicants, maintaining moderately selective standards. Prospective students typically need to provide high school transcript, minimum GPA, and letters of recommendation. The process is designed to enroll qualified students, with 348 students enrolling in the most recent class.

University of Dallas enrolls 2,182 students. The student body is 51.8% women, with diverse representation across programs. The college maintains a 81% retention rate, reflecting student satisfaction and academic support.

University of Dallas maintains a 11:1 student-to-faculty ratio, providing exceptional opportunities for personalized instruction and academic support. The college maintains a excellent 81% retention rate for full-time students, reflecting student satisfaction and effective academic programs. University of Dallas employs 129 instructional staff members dedicated to student success. The 11:1 student-to-faculty ratio provides excellent opportunities for personalized attention and mentoring. With 25.4% of faculty holding tenure, students benefit from experienced educators committed to teaching excellence.

Annual tuition at University of Dallas is $47,300 for in-state students. After financial aid, the average net price is $31,221 (average savings of $16,079). Students can use the net price calculator to estimate their individual costs and potential aid.
